Question : A body slides down a frictionless track which ends in a circular loop of diameter 𝐷. Then the minimum height ℎ of the body in terms of 𝐷 so that it may just complete the loop, is

(A) h=\dfrac{5}{2}D

(B) h=\dfrac{3}{2}D

(C) h=\dfrac{5}{4}D

(D) ℎ = 2D

Answer : option (C)
